US Dow completes construction of 400,000 tonne/year PE plant
Stefan Baumgarten
06-Jun-2017
HOUSTON (ICIS)–Dow Chemical has completed construction
of a new 400,000 tonne/year polyethylene (PE) plant at
Freeport, Texas, the US-based chemicals major said in an
update on Tuesday.
The PE unit is the first of four new derivative
investments under way at Dow’s manufacturing sites in
Texas and Louisiana as part of the company’s previously
announced $6bn expansion on the US Gulf Coast.
The PE unit now enters its commissioning and start-up phase
in sequence with the mid-year start-up of Dow’s 1.5m
tonne/year ethylene facility at Freeport.
The PE plant is expected to ramp up during the third quarter
and be fully operational in the fourth quarter. It will
produce ELITE-brand PE resins for use in flexible
packaging applications for food, personal hygiene products
and industrial packaging.
“The mechanical completion of our first new PE unit is yet
another milestone that brings us closer to having more volume
to meet growing customer demand globally,” said Diego Donoso,
business president for Dow’s packaging and specialty plastics
business.
Dow’s other three derivative units along with a planned
debottleneck are proceeding on schedule and are staged to
come online throughout 2017 and 2018, the company
added.
The three derivatives plants are a new 350,000 tonne/year
specialty low density PE plant which is also expected to come
online in coordination with the cracker; a 200,000 tonne/year
ethylenepropylene diene monomer (EPDM), expected to start up
in early 2018; and a 320,000 tonne/year specialty and
conventional polyolefin elastomers plant, expected to come
online in late 2018.
